Mochi Nyan unveils Hong Kong experience zone and Taipei Metro wrap

From 11 July to 16 August 2026, the Taiwanese mascot Mochi Nyan will host a large‑scale experiential zone in Hong Kong at Sheung Shui Centre and MCPOne. The two venues feature themed “Mochi Bakery” and “Mochi Convenience Store” installations, interactive games, photo spots and limited‑edition merchandise. Visitors can earn “Mochi energy” calories that are converted into donations for the HUNGER RUN 2026 charity run.

In Taipei, the Metro will introduce a new “Fantasy Fairy Tale” wrapped train on the Bannan line starting in July 2026. The design showcases Mochi Nyan characters such as Nyakazukin‑chan and Mochi Snow Princess, turning the carriage into a moving storybook. The rollout includes special photo areas, limited‑edition Easy‑Travel cards and upgraded train amenities, reinforcing the mascot’s family‑friendly brand across Taiwan’s public transport.
